Output e77e69eda0bea987e6f3ff500f18c6d03dd90b73737305f168fd696f43e5f568:2

value
140338590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 609ef21280b0e5873aee24d4b23b56b0054ce592 OP_EQUAL
address
MGi3WaZWerxYW2RZehE9BoMYdtLYRwivYE
transaction
e77e69eda0bea987e6f3ff500f18c6d03dd90b73737305f168fd696f43e5f568
spent
true